401. Heav'n has confirm'd the great decree

1 Heav'n has confirm'd the great decree
That Adam's race must die:
One gen'ral ruin sweeps them down,
And low in dust they lie.

2 Ye living men, the tomb survey,
Where you must quickly dwell.
Hark how the awful summons sounds
In ev'ry fun'ral knell!

3 Once you must die, and once for all;
The solemn purport weigh;
For know, that heav'n and hell are hung
On that important day.

4 Those eyes, so long in darkness veil'd,
Must wake the Judge to see;
And ev'ry word, and ev'ry thought
Must pass his scrutiny.

5 O may I in the Judge behold
My Savior and my Friend,
And far beyond the reach of death
With all his saints ascend!

Text Information
First Line: Heav'n has confirm'd the great decree
Meter: C. M.
Language: English
Publication Date: 1845
Topic: Consummation of Things: Judgment and Eternity
Notes: Now Public Domain.
